Estimated Price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$5,000 - $15,000 (full roof replacement)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or Damage Repair |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Partial Roof Replacement | $4,000 - $8,000 |
| Full Roof Replacement | $5,000 - $15,000 |
| Roof Inspection & Assessment | $300 - $700 |
| Storm Damage Repair | $2,000 - $10,000 |
Key Cost Considerations
Damaged roof replacement in Bristol County, RI, involves removing existing roofing materials and installing new components to restore protection and functionality. The scope and complexity of such projects can vary based on several factors, including materials used, roof size, and local permitting requirements.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and comparing options for roof replacement services.
- Materials: Options often include asphalt shingles, metal panels, or cedar shakes, each with different durability and cost considerations.
- Size and Scope: Larger roofs or complex designs may require more materials and labor, impacting overall project duration and cost.
- Labor Complexity: Roofs with multiple levels, steep slopes, or intricate features can increase installation difficulty and time.
- Permitting: Local building codes in Bristol County typically require permits for roof replacement, which may involve inspections and approval processes.
- Extras: Additional services such as gutter replacement, ventilation upgrades, or insulation may be included or added to the project scope.
Project Size & Details
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small repair (partial replacement of damaged shingles) |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Moderate replacement (section of roof or multiple damaged areas) | $3,000 - $8,000 |
| Full roof replacement (entire roof of average size) | $8,000 - $15,000 |
| Large or complex projects (multiple layers or specialty materials) | $15,000 and up |
